Albany Staffing Agency Explains to Not Encourage a Workplace Gossiper



As a species, there are times where we can't help but discuss the actions of others with our peers. We like to talk, and we especially love to talk about people who act or are going through moments less-than-perfect experiences and moments. There's something about knowing something others don't and being able to let them in on "the secret" that gives us a rush of pleasure, which encourages us to keep doing it. However, when facts and opinions start to merge, gossiping can be a very hurtful thing. False information spreads in the workplace, which can be a very harmful thing if you're trying to be career focused. The employment agency in Albany shares how to not encourage workplace gossip in a couple of ways.

Gossiping Can Encourage Negativity

It's rare that people who are gossiping are spreading positive information. By spreading negative information about someone, you are also encouraging negativity and hurtful feelings and mindsets. 
Most gossip stems from a sense of self-doubt and desire to bring someone else down. For example, a co-worker may have received a promotion, and you're feeling down because you didn't receive it. Because you have negative feelings towards yourself, you might start talking to others about that co-worker. You might not actively mean to spread nastiness, but you are.

If They’ll Talk About Others, They’ll Talk About You

What goes around comes around has never been truer when it comes to gossiping. If you're participating in workplace gossip, think of how it would feel to be on the other end of this because it's only a matter of time before you are. No one's perfect, and everyone messes up sometimes; but if you think your gossipy friend won't talk about you when you mess up, you'll be in for a rude awakening.
So, the next time your gossipy friend wants to chat about someone else's shortcomings, do the right thing by not spreading their negativity, explains the Albany staffing agency.
